Revision 714: Kirby, KI und die Verantwortung langlebiger Software, mit Bastian Allgeier
Wir sprechen mit Bastian Allgeier (Web / Mastodon / Bluesky / LinkedIn) darüber, wie sich Kirby nach mehr als 14 Jahren weiterentwickelt und was es bedeutet, ein kommerzielles CMS langfristig zu pflegen. Dabei geht es um Verantwortung gegenüber Kundinnen, Kunden und Community, um Wartbarkeit, Refactoring und die Frage, warum Beständigkeit gerade in schnelllebigen Zeiten ein eigenes Feature ist.
Außerdem diskutieren wir, wie sich KI auf CMS-Entwicklung, Content-Workflows, Plugins, Support und Produktentscheidungen auswirkt. Bastian beschreibt, warum Kirby KI nicht als fest eingebautes Kernfeature behandelt, sondern weiterhin auf Offenheit, Erweiterbarkeit und Unabhängigkeit setzt.
Shownotes
- [00:00:59] Kirby, KI und die Verantwortung langlebiger Software
Bastian erzählt, wie aus einem Nebenprojekt für eigene Kundenprojekte nach und nach Kirby wurde. Seit 2017 arbeitet er Vollzeit daran. Wir erinnern uns an frühere Besuche bei Working Draft, unter anderem Revision 592 zu zehn Jahren Kirby und Revision 167, sowie an Bastians Auftritt bei der Nightly Build.Ausgehend von einem Talk von Oliver Reichenstein über iA Writer sprechen wir darüber, warum schnell erzeugte Software nicht dasselbe ist wie über Jahre gepflegte Software. Bastian betont, dass der eigentliche Aufwand oft erst nach dem ersten funktionierenden Prototyp beginnt: Wartung, Support, Weiterentwicklung, Migrationspfade, alte Abhängigkeiten und das Vertrauen der Nutzerinnen und Nutzer.
Ein großer Teil der Diskussion dreht sich um KI und sogenannte Vibe-Coding-Workflows. Bastian beobachtet, dass KI den Wechsel von anderen Systemen zu Kirby erleichtern kann, weil Migrationen schneller umsetzbar werden. Auch Plugins lassen sich heute leichter für spezifische Projekte bauen. Gleichzeitig entstehen neue Support-Probleme, wenn KI falschen Code erzeugt und Nutzerinnen und Nutzer die Fehler zunächst dem CMS zuschreiben.
Wir sprechen darüber, warum Kirbys dateibasierter Ansatz in dieser neuen Werkzeuglandschaft unerwartet gut funktioniert. Inhalte und Code liegen als Text vor, wodurch KI-Werkzeuge leichter Kontext erfassen können, ohne erst komplexe Datenbankzugriffe oder Schnittstellen zu benötigen. Kirby wird dabei weniger als klassisches Plug-and-Play-CMS beschrieben, sondern eher als flexibler Werkzeugkasten oder Klebersystem zwischen Website, Apps, Enterprise-Systemen und individuellen Workflows.
Bei KI-Features im Produkt selbst bleibt Bastian vorsichtig. Kirby soll weiterhin selbst gehostet auf einfachen Setups ebenso laufen wie auf größeren Servern. Feste Abhängigkeiten zu Anbietern wie OpenAI oder Anthropic passen aus seiner Sicht nicht gut zu diesem Anspruch. Wer KI integrieren möchte, kann das über eigene Erweiterungen oder bestehende Plugins aus dem Kirby Plugin-Verzeichnis tun, etwa über die Suche nach AI-Plugins.
Gleichzeitig beschreibt Bastian die ethische und strategische Ambivalenz im Umgang mit KI. Kirby hat viele Nutzerinnen und Nutzer aus Design, Kunst, NGOs und nachhaltig arbeitenden Projekten, die KI teils sehr kritisch sehen. Das Team will deshalb weder KI ignorieren noch unreflektiert alles darauf ausrichten. Wichtig bleibt, die eigene Unabhängigkeit zu bewahren und nicht in einen technischen oder gedanklichen Lock-in zu geraten.
Zum Schluss schauen wir auf die nächsten Schritte: Die Kirby Konf soll im September in Mainz die Community zusammenbringen, bewusst in kleinem Rahmen mit Talks und Session-Formaten. Außerdem arbeitet das Team an Kirby 6, inklusive größerem Refactoring, Vue-3-Umstieg, TypeScript-Arbeit und Änderungen an der Authentifizierung. Die aktuelle Alpha ist bereits als Kirby 6.0.0 Alpha 2 verfügbar.
Links
- Kirby for Artists
Kirbys Einstiegsseite für Künstlerinnen und Künstler, passend zur im Gespräch erwähnten Design- und Kreativ-Community.
- Kirby for Clients
Eine Kirby-Seite für Kundinnen und Kunden, die erklärt, wie das CMS in Projekten eingesetzt werden kann.
- Kirby Community
Das Community-Forum rund um Kirby, Support, Plugins und Projektfragen.
- Kirby kaufen
Die Lizenz- und Kaufseite für Kirby.
Anhören
MP3 herunterladen (58,3 MB) | TranskriptFeedback-Kanäle
Wenn du diese Informationen hilfreich findest und eine KI dir davon erzählt hat, freuen wir uns, wenn du den Working Draft Podcast abonnierst.